What is the function of an independent commission? 🔊
An independent commission functions to oversee specific tasks without direct influence from political parties or government bodies. These commissions often address areas like elections, public policy, or research, providing unbiased recommendations and expertise. By operating independently, these commissions can promote transparency, improve governance, and ensure that important issues are addressed fairly and effectively, thereby strengthening democratic processes.
